AMD and Anthropic reach $5 billion AI infrastructure deal


AMD says it’s going to invest up to $5 billion in Anthropic, while helping to expand the AI company’s computing power, according to an announcement on Wednesday. As part of the new partnership, Anthropic will deploy up to 2 gigawatts of AMD’s Instinct MI450 AI GPUs using the chipmaker’s new Helios rack-scale system, as reported earlier by The Wall Street Journal.

The companies plan to deploy the first gigawatt in the first half of 2027, building upon recent data center deals Anthropic has reached with SpaceX and TeraWulf. Anthropic has also signed AI infrastructure deals with Google, Broadcom, and Amazon, with rumors suggesting that it could reach an agreement with Meta as well.

AMD and Anthropic will also launch a “multi-year engineering collaboration,” where AMD will use Anthropic’s Claude across its software development, engineering, and product development. “By partnering with AMD across the stack, we are securing the capacity we need and optimizing it for training and serving Claude,” Tom Brown, Anthropic co-founder and chief compute officer, says in the press release.
